Fluharty To Appear On PBS Show

Del. Shawn Fluharty, D-Ohio, will appear at 9 p.m. Tuesday on the PBS program “Breaking the Deadlock.” The program is designed to encourage civil dialogue at a time when conversation is polarized. The series brings together a varied panel of prominent voices from the legal, political and cultural arenas to explore ethical dilemmas drawn from real life.

Tuesday’s episode deals with online sports gambling. Fluharty, head of governmental affairs at Play n’GO, joins a panel that includes sitting U.S. Sen. Richard Blumenthal, D-Conn., former NFL player Tiki Barber, MS NOW’s Stephanie Rhule, ESPN’s Anita Marks and others.

Ohio Co. GOP Hosting Candidate Meet and Greet

The Ohio County Republican Executive Committee is inviting the public to come meet the GOP candidates on the Ohio County ballot in the May 2026 primary election.

The committee is hosting a “Meet and Greet” set for March 26 at The Scottish Rite Cathedral. Doors will open at 5:30 p.m., with the program set to begin at 6 p.m.

Each candidate will get an opportunity to deliver their platform in a timed speech. The Ohio County Executive Committee is offering this as an educational tool for constituents to learn more about the candidates who are running to represent them.

A $20 donation is requested, and there will be appetizers and refreshments available.

Quarter auction to benefit fair

WELLSBURG — A quarter auction to benefit the Brooke County Fair will be held April 19 at the Wellsburg Moose Lodge. Doors open at 12:30 p.m., with the bidding to begin at 1:30 p.m. The event also will include drawings, food for sale and free prizes.

Admission is $5, which includes one paddle for bidding. Additional paddles will be available for $1 each at the door.

Those who purchase tickets before April 1 will be entered into a special prize drawing. Seats will be reserved for groups of six or more who purchase advance tickets.

The tickets may be purchased at the Brooke Hills Park clubhouse, brookecountyfair.com, from any fair committee member or at the door.

For information, call 304-737-1236.

The fair will be held Sept. 18-20 at Brooke Hills Park.

Part of Halls Road to close

A portion of Brooke County Route 1/7 (Halls Road) in Colliers from milepost 1.0 to milepost 1.72 will be closed from 7 a.m. to 5 p.m. beginning on Monday, March 23, through Wednesday, March 25, for tree trimming. Emergency vehicles and school buses will be accommodated. Motorists are advised to slow down and expect delays.

Alternate routes include County Route 12 (Mechling Hill Road) or County Route 27 (Eldersville Road).

Inclement weather or unforeseen circumstances could change the project schedule.
